Iran Tried to Assassinate Trump: Alleged Plot Leader Killed, US Says

Washington D.C. – The U.S. Military has confirmed the killing of a senior Iranian official accused of leading a unit responsible for plotting the assassination of former President Donald Trump. The announcement, made Wednesday by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th, marks a significant escalation in ongoing tensions between the United States and Iran, and comes amidst a broader U.S. Military campaign targeting Iranian assets. The operation took place on Tuesday, according to the Pentagon.

Hegseth stated emphatically, “The leader of the unit who attempted to assassinate President Trump has been hunted down and killed. Iran tried to kill President Trump and President Trump got the last laugh.” This statement underscores the Trump administration’s long-held belief that Iran posed a direct threat to the former president’s life, a claim that has been consistently denied by Tehran. The official’s identity has not yet been publicly released.

Alleged Assassination Plot and Prior Accusations

The U.S. Justice Department first brought charges in 2024 against an Iranian man allegedly connected to the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C) for his involvement in the plot to assassinate Trump while he was still president-elect. Reuters reports that the recent operation was a direct response to this alleged threat. While Hegseth acknowledged that targeting this individual wasn’t the primary objective of current military actions, he affirmed his commitment to pursuing those responsible for the plot. “While that was not the focus of the effort by any stretch of the imagination – in fact, never raised by the President or anybody else – I ensured, and others ensured, that those who were responsible for that were eventually part of the target list,” he told reporters.

The roots of this animosity trace back to 2020, when then-President Trump authorized a drone strike that killed General Qasem Soleimani, Iran’s most prominent military commander, in Iraq. This action triggered retaliatory measures from Iran and significantly heightened tensions in the region. The Independent notes that during the 2024 presidential race, Trump’s campaign was alerted to potential threats from Iran, including reports of “kill teams” operating within the United States.

Broader U.S. Military Campaign Against Iran

The killing of the Iranian official is occurring in the context of a wider military campaign initiated by the United States. Hegseth described the results of this campaign as “incredible” and “historic,” detailing the sinking of an Iranian warship by an American submarine and asserting that the U.S. Is on the verge of achieving “complete control” of Iranian skies. He emphasized the unique capabilities of the U.S. Military in leading this operation. “We are only four days into this, and the results have been incredible, historic really … Only the United States of America could lead this,” Hegseth said.

This escalation follows a joint U.S.-Israel bombing campaign targeting Iranian interests. Details regarding the specific targets and objectives of this campaign remain limited, but the Pentagon has indicated a focus on disrupting Iran’s military capabilities. The timing of these actions suggests a deliberate strategy to exert maximum pressure on Iran, though the long-term goals remain unclear.

Iran’s Response and International Implications

Tehran has consistently denied any involvement in plots to harm U.S. Officials, dismissing the accusations as baseless propaganda. The Iranian government has yet to officially respond to the news of the killed official, but it is expected to condemn the action as a violation of international law and an act of aggression. USA Today reports that this latest development is likely to further complicate diplomatic efforts to de-escalate tensions in the Middle East.

The international community is closely monitoring the situation, with concerns mounting over the potential for a wider conflict. Several nations have urged restraint and called for a return to diplomatic negotiations. The European Union, in a statement released Wednesday, expressed its deep concern over the escalating violence and emphasized the importance of upholding international law. The potential for regional instability remains high, particularly given the involvement of other actors, such as Israel and various proxy groups operating throughout the Middle East.
